...he's at every protest carrying a black sign with green and red letters--usually something cryptic and creative concerning the current president, space/aliens and 12 galaxies. The venue 12 galaxies is named in honor of him, and at many a shows (he never has to pay) I've seen him chowing down front row on popeyes chicken.

I've talked to him a couple of times, very polite guy, you wouldn't know he was crazy until he starts telling you about how the CIA is trying to keep his family out of hollywood or something like that. the venue 12 galaxies is named after him, which is awesome. he shows up literally everywhere, especially at rallies and other protests where he can make his message heard and get on camera. i don't know how he makes a living, but a couple years ago he did start carrying an advertisement on the back of his protest sign.
